The Physiological Effects Of A Mindfulness-based Exercise Program On The Stress-levels Of College-age Females

Medicine & Science in Sports & Exercise May 1, 2011 Andrew Cisneros, Jacalyn J. Robert-McComb, Norman Reid et al.

A Mindfulness-Based Exercise Program (MBEP) includes techniques from the traditional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ction (MBSR) program and incorporates exercise as a mindfulness technique. The goal of this intervention is to teach individuals how to cope with stressors since high stress levels are associated with disease.
